Alan, Bobby and Chris are comparing their ages. The ratio of Alan’s age to Bobby’s is 7 : 8 and the ratio of Bobby’s to Chris’ is 5 : 4. If Alan is 70, how old is Chris?

Answer: 64 yrs

Explanation:

To find Chris' age, we can follow these steps:

Step 1: Determine Bobby's age.

Given that the ratio of Alan's age to Bobby's age is 7:8, and we know that Alan is 70, we can set up the following equation:

Alan's age / Bobby's age = 7/8

70 / Bobby's age = 7/8

Cross-multiplying, we have:

8 * 70 = 7 * Bobby's age

560 = 7 * Bobby's age

Divide both sides by 7:

Bobby's age = 560 / 7

Bobby's age = 80

So, Bobby is 80 years old.

Step 2: Determine Chris' age.

Given that the ratio of Bobby's age to Chris' age is 5:4, we can set up the following equation:

Bobby's age / Chris' age = 5/4

Substituting Bobby's age as 80, we have:

80 / Chris' age = 5/4

Cross-multiplying, we get:

4 * 80 = 5 * Chris' age

320 = 5 * Chris' age

Divide both sides by 5:

Chris' age = 320 / 5

Chris' age = 64

Therefore, Chris is 64 years old.
